MacStoutNov 15, 2006Still a good game, I didn't go to deep for the time being, just few hours playing but frankly speaking I haven't seen a lot of differences with Rome Total War, same global map and interface, same combat map and stategies and no real improvement in graphics. Overall it's a good game for people who liked Total war series but its not a new one, just kind of RTW mod.

PC GamerA bigger, prettier, and more addictive game that leaves even the series' most recent efforts in the dust...If you think "Rome: Total War's" battles looked good, especially for the number of units on-screen at once (i.e., thousands), Medieval II will blow you away. [Dec 2006, p.28]
-
PC Gamer UKMesmerisingly challenging... If there's another wargame that blends geopolitics with tactics this brilliantly, or portrays war so memorably, then I'm unaware of it... The new king of wargames. [Dec 2006, p.56]
-
Pelit (Finland)Take the contents and theme from Medieval. Mix them with eye candy from "Rome," add some spice and you have a winner on your hands. [Dec 2006, p.82]
